Green & Sustainable

Sustainable and eco-friendly activities, experiences and places to stay.

Planning a 'green' break to the Peak District and Derbyshire has never been easier. Britain's original National Park is the perfect place to enjoy slow travel, where you sit back, relax and soak up the views whilst you explore by foot, bike, bus or train.

Green transport, including an excellent local network of buses and trains, is at the heart of a visit to the Peak District and Derbyshire, and there are lots of eco-friendly activities to enjoy in the area: including cycle routes, ebiking experiences, and walking trails.

Being green doesn’t have to mean giving up luxury and comforts either. If you truly want to connect to nature and sleep under stars with all the amenities of your home, then glamping is the perfect way to travel green.

The Peak District and Derbyshire is dotted with carbon-neutral and eco-friendly places to stay including environmentally-friendly hotels, lodges and cottages, plus lots of electric car charging points too.
